Is It Ok To Eat Fried Food Sometimes?

The bottom line. Consuming foods fried in unstable oils can have several negative health effects. In fact, eating them regularly can put you at a higher risk of developing diseases like diabetes, heart disease and obesity. Therefore, it’s probably best to avoid or severely limit your intake of commercially fried foods.

Is fried food okay in moderation?

The idea of moderation in all things is believed to have come from an ancient Greek poet. But when it comes to fried food, even moderation may need some rethinking. New research finds each four-ounce serving of fried food per week boosts the risk of stroke and major heart disease.

How much calories does frying add?

Here is what we learned about the calories in deep-frying:
​ Dense foods that absorb very little oil still gain over 50% more calories when they are deep-fried. For example, if you take a raw chicken breast and toss it naked into a fryer, you increase the calories by 64%. This is far higher than we would have imagined.

Is fried chicken unhealthy?

More specifically, eating fried chicken had a 13% greater risk of death and 12% increased risk of a heart-related death. For fried fish, the rise in risk of death and heart-related death was 7% and 13%, respectively.

What does fried food do to your stomach?

The problem with fried foods is the same as with fatty foods — they can move, undigested, through the body too quickly, leading to diarrhea, or stay in your digestive tract too long, causing you to feel full and bloated. Many fried foods are low in fiber and take longer to digest.

Why is frying so unhealthy?

Fried foods are high in saturated fat and trans fat, so they promote plaque buildup in arteries that can put you at risk for coronary artery disease, heart failure, heart attack, and stroke. There are small steps you can take to make fried foods healthier or to help limit them altogether.

How many calories should I eat a day?

How many calories should I eat a day? Adult females need anywhere from 1,600 to 2,400 calories a day and adult males need anywhere from 2,000 to 3,000 calories a day, according to the USDA’s latest “Dietary Guidelines for Americans” report released in 2020.
